    Activision creates community app for Call of Duty players
    A new online community service has been announced for Call of Duty.

    Call of Duty: Elite goes into public beta in the summer and will be released with Modern Warfare 3, due out in November.

    The Elite service will be available across web, mobile, TV and console, for PS3, Xbox 360 and PC gamers. Parts of it will be free to use, but for the more hardcore gamers there is a premium element with a monthly fee.

    It's been a long time since we've heard much on the new rune system in Diablo 3. For those who have forgotten -- it's been a while since BlizzCon 2008, after all -- Diablo 3 players can modify every class skill with a runestone. In the early version of the system, runestones came in fairly self-explanatory flavors. A multistrike rune, for instance, would add extra hits to a given skill.
